- Outstanding Mechanical Properties: ELEGOO PETG-CF filament is made from a combination of PETG and carbon fibers for extra strength. It has higher impact resistance than common carbon fiber filaments, and is less prone to fracture under external stress.
- Abrasion Resistance And Dimensional Accuracy: This PETG-CF filament excels in abrasion resistance and maintains high dimensional consistency, making it ideal for printing functional parts like gears, bearings and structural components that require precise fit.
- Premium Print Finish And Usage Tips: The added carbon fiber brings a distinct fine matte texture that reduces visible layer lines. It works with most 1.75 mm FDM printers, recommend to use hardened steel nozzle above 0.4 mm at 240 to 270 C print temp and 65 to 75 C hotbed temp.
- High Quality PLA Filament Performance: ELEGOO PLA filament is made of premium thermoplastic with low melting temperature, low warpage and shrinkage, odorless during printing, and delivers a glossy surface finish. Pre-dried and vacuum sealed, it brings smooth extrusion without clogging or bubbling issues.
- User Friendly Design And Wide Compatibility: The 1 kg 2.2 lbs PLA spool is neatly wound with strict manual examination to avoid tangling and filament breakage. The larger inner diameter supports easy feeding, and fits most common 1.75 mm FDM 3D printers.

Printing ELEGOO PETG-CF
ELEGOO PETG-CF in Blue runs on the standard PETG-CF profile below, and this listing is a 1.00kg spool. PETG-CF is best suited to functional parts that need toughness and the light outdoor or higher-heat use PLA can't handle. Brands and even individual spools vary, so treat these as starting points and run a quick temperature tower to lock in the sweet spot for your printer.
